When Is the Cheapest Time to Visit Marco Island?
The best time to visit Marco Island on a budget is late summer through early fall (August through October). This is considered off-season due to higher temperatures and the potential for rain, but it also means fewer crowds, lower hotel rates, and better travel deals. Other low-cost travel windows include:
-
Early December (before the holiday rush)
-
Late April to early June (after spring break but before summer peak)
If you’re flexible with your dates, you’ll score the best savings during these shoulder seasons.

2. Tigertail Beach
Tigertail Beach is a local favorite with a low entrance fee and tons of natural beauty. It’s perfect for beachcombing, birdwatching, paddleboarding, or just relaxing under the sun.
3. Frank E. Mackle Park
A great free option for families, this local park has a splash pad, walking paths, and a scenic lake—all at no cost.
4. Shelling at South Marco Beach
Shelling is a popular activity on Marco Island, and South Marco Beach is a fantastic spot to find unique shells. Bring your own bag or bucket and enjoy nature’s free souvenirs.

Best Places to Stay on a Budget
Accommodations are the biggest expense in Marco Island, but you can still find great deals:
-
Look for rentals or resorts offering off-season rates
-
Book midweek instead of weekends
-
Check nearby Naples or East Naples for lower nightly prices
